The Hospice Aide is a member of the Hospice interdisciplinary team who works under the direction of the RN case manager to provide personal care, homemaker services, and companionship to hospice patients. The Hospice Aide ensures that high standards of care are met at all times

Responsibilities:
Essential Functions/Responsibilities:
  • Uses appropriate and safe techniques in performing personal hygiene and grooming tasks such as bed or tub bath, shower assistance, hair care, oral hygiene, toileting and incontinence care, light housekeeping, and other tasks assigned by the RN case manager
  • Completes telephony care plan accurately and in a timely manner while being compliant with the hospice program policies and procedures
  • Creates successful interpersonal relationships with patients/families while maintaining personal and professional boundaries
  • Reports changes in the patient’s medical, nursing, and social needs to the RN case manager as the changes relate to the plan of care
Qualifications:
Education: High School diploma or GED. Completion of a Nursing Assistant Training Program of a minimum of 75 hours. Valid Iowa or Illinois certification.
Preferred or Specialized: 2-5 years hospice experience in a nursing or hospice facility Completion of a 120 hour Nursing Assistant course and holds current State of Iowa Certification.
